Abstract: Objective To evaluate and compare the molluscicidal effects of colorless and black plastic film covering methods against Oncomelania hupensis snails in hilly regions. Methods A hilly setting with high snail density was selected as the study ar? ea,and three groups including the colorless plastic film covering method,black plastic film covering method and control were de? signed. The snail surveys were conducted 1,3,7,15 days and 30 days in each group following plastic film covering,and the mor? tality of snails and reduction of snail density were investigated. The air temperature,soil surface temperature in the control group, as well as the soil surface temperature and the temperatures 5 cm and 15 cm under the soil within the film were recorded. Results The mortality rates of snails were 36.84%,78.94%,95.92%,100.00% and 99.45% 1,3,7,15 days and 30 days following color? less plastic film covering,respectively,and the snail density after 30 days of covering reduced by 99.36% as compared to that be? fore covering,while the mortality rates of snails were 10.08%,8.94%,6.11%,26.15% and 49.32% 1,3,7,15 days and 30 days following black plastic film covering,respectively,and the snail density after 30 days of covering reduced by 58.10% as com? pared to that before covering. There were significant differences in the 1?,3?,7?,15?day and 30?day snail mortality rates between the colorless and black film covering groups(all P values < 0.01),and a significant difference was detected in the snail density be? tween the two groups 30 days after the film covering(P < 0.001) . In addition,the speed,amplitude and duration of the rise in the soil surface temperature within the colorless film were all greater than those within the black film. Conclusion The short ? term molluscicidal effect of the colorless plastic film covering method is significantly superior to that of the black plastic film covering method in summer in hilly regions.
